Andrew's ILM Level 5 Journey as Director at Katronic Technologies

Our ILM Level 5 qualification, Institute of Leadership & Management (ILM), is designed to develop the leadership and management skills of professionals at a middle management level. It covers a range of topics including strategic planning, decision-making, managing change, and leading teams effectively. The programme aims to enhance leadership capabilities, improve performance, and equip individuals with the skills needed to succeed in more senior roles within their organisations.

A brief introduction about yourself and your job role?

“My name is Andrew Sutton and I am managing Director of Katronic Technologies an award-winning Coventry-based manufacturer of innovative flow measurement technologies for the Industrial and Water sectors. 2024 will be the 25th anniversary of my time at Katronic during which period we have grown from three people in a small office in Coventry to nearly 40 people across four sites in the UK, Germany, France and the US.”

Why ILM level 5 is beneficial?

“In its simplest form it has provided a safe space for the other managers on the course to discuss ongoing issues and opportunities within our respective companies. It offers a relaxed learning environment with an excellent tutor who guides us through the various topics in an interesting and inciteful way. It is also giving me the chance to revisit many areas of management strategy that I have not looked at since my time at university whilst also updating me on the latest thinking in this area.”

What training have you found particularly useful in relation to your job role?

“The most interesting areas I have looked at, and ones on which I am doing further work privately, are emotional intelligence and active listening. These were areas of study that were new to me and ones that I think have the most impact and benefit on my day-to-day working life.”
